  • Title

    Investigation of 3-channel all-optical regeneration in a group-delay-managed nonlinear medium

  • Abstract
    We investigate three-channel performance of a stand-alone Mamyshev 2R regenerator based on Raman-assisted group-delay-managed medium. Our results indicate, for the first time to our knowledge, the feasibility of simultaneous regeneration of 100-GHz-spaced WDM channels.
